  • 2024 Oklahoma Regatta Festival

    The Oklahoma Regatta Festival is set to take place from October 4 to 6, 2024, on the Oklahoma River, marking the 20th anniversary of the Oklahoma City University Head of the Oklahoma Regatta. This vibrant three-day event offers an array of activities and experiences for participants and spectators alike, with live streaming available on both Saturday and Sunday.

    Attendees can expect thrilling competitions including the RIVERSPORT Rowing, Rafting, and Dragon Boat League Championships, alongside the OG&E NightSprints races. The festival will feature a variety of delicious food options, family-friendly fun, and spectacular fireworks to conclude the racing events on Friday and Saturday evenings. Visitors are encouraged to engage in the festive atmosphere by participating in the “lighting up the night” theme, showcasing glowing costumes and accessories as they support their teams.

    On Sunday, participants of all ages can join PaddleMania at the whitewater center, allowing for personal involvement through raft-building competitions, team tug-o-war, and an exciting raft race. Registration for this activity is currently open, highlighting the inclusive spirit of the festival.

    The event schedule includes:

    - **Friday, October 4**: OG&E NightSprints and RIVERSPORT Championships from 5 PM to 10 PM, ending the day with fireworks.
